Latest Patents

Kasia's latest patents include innovative methods for data processing. One of her notable inventions is a method for declarative entity segmentation. This method involves displaying a variety of attributes at a user interface, which are defined by a data model tailored for a tenant of a multi-tenant system. The attributes include a one-to-many attribute that supports multiple inputs and a direct attribute for single input. The process allows for the selection of a first one-to-many attribute to define an expression for identifying a segment of entities. Additionally, her patent on generalizing a segment from user data attributes enables a data server to support segment identification based on a selected user profile. This invention allows for the identification of attributes associated with a user identifier and the generation of expressions to query additional user profiles.
